3AW Breakfast speaks with Reykjavik pub owner after Iceland stuns England
Iceland has caused one of the great sporting upsets of recent times, knocking England out of Euro 2016.
Iceland, with less than 100 professional footballers, stunned England 2-1 in France.
The loss saw Roy Hodgson resign as England manager.
He was on around $5 million (Australian) a year.
To put that into perspective, one of Iceland’s joint-managers works part-time as a dentist.
3AW Breakfast spoke with Gunnar Guelaugsson, who owns a pub in Reykjavik – the capital of Iceland.
‘It’s going to be a good night,’ he said.
‘It’s like independence day and every Saturday night ever rolled into one!’
